As a Senior Product Marketing Manager for Sage X3, you'll define and deliver the positioning, messaging, and go-to-market strategy for Sage's ERP solution in the manufacturing and distribution industries - with a focus on add-ons and integrations across the broader Sage suite. This is a global role, with the majority of your work (around 80%) focused on the U.S. market. You'll translate product capabilities into clear, differentiated stories, guide launch and growth plans, and enable sales and marketing teams to support customer retention and growth.

Required Qualifications:
- 5+ years of experience in product marketing or product management.
- Background in ERP, manufacturing, supply chain, or SaaS software.
- Strong ability to define positioning, messaging, and go-to-market strategies for complex products.
- Experience developing pricing and promotional strategies that balance growth and profitability.
- Skilled at creating clear, compelling presentations and sales enablement materials.
- Confident communicator, comfortable presenting to executives, customers, and large audiences.
- Proven track record of cross-functional collaboration with product, sales, and marketing teams.
- Strong project management skills, with experience managing multiple initiatives and tight deadlines.
- Experience conducting market research and competitive analysis to inform strategy and positioning

Key Responsibilities
- Define Sage X3's positioning, value propositions, and go-to-market messaging for manufacturing and distribution.
- Build and manage product launch plans aligned with business and revenue goals, ensuring ongoing market relevance and pipeline growth.
- Partner with Product Management to translate product functionality and benefits into clear, differentiated messaging.
- Develop pricing and promotional strategies that balance growth, retention, and long-term profitability.
- Support the launch and growth of complementary Sage solutions such as Sage Supply Chain Intelligence and Sage Copilot.
- Create impactful presentations and sales training materials to equip sales teams and communicate Sage X3's value to internal and external audiences.
- Collaborate with regional marketing teams on industry-specific campaigns that drive awareness and demand.
- Act as an ambassador for Sage X3 in the market, contributing to thought leadership and building relationships with partners and industry stakeholders.
Benefits? We have plenty...
- 100% paid premiums for health, dental, and vision coverage
- RRSP contribution match (100% up to 4%)
- 35 days paid time off (11 holidays, 16 vacation days, 3 personal days, 5 sick days)
- Work Away, an opportunity to work & play for 10 weeks in a country of your choice (from a Sage-approved list)
- 18 weeks of paid parental leave for birth, adoption, or surrogacy offered 1 year after your start date
- 5 days paid yearly to volunteer (through Sage Foundation)
- $5,250 tuition reimbursement per calendar year starting 6 months after your hire date
- Sage Wellness Rewards Program (annual fitness reimbursement)
- Library of on-demand career development options and ongoing training offerings
Compensation offered will be determined by factors such as location, level, job-related knowledge, education, and experience. Certain provinces in Canada require job postings to include a reasonable estimate of the salary range applicable to the role. For this role, in those locations, the target base salary range for new hires is C$140,000 to C$160,000. In addition to base salary, employees will participate in a bonus plan (20%) based on company and individual performance.
